Bill Type and Number:  Ordinance 2006-888

 

Sponsor:  Council President at the Request of the Mayor

 

Date of Introduction:  August 8, 2006

 

Committee(s) of Reference:  F

 

Date of Analysis:  August 10, 2006

 

Type of Action:  Financing Plan Revisions/Repeal of Ordinance/Amendment of Ordinance

 

Bill Summary:  This bill makes technical changes to the City’s Special Revenue Bond program, which was established for the financing of municipal capital improvements and other governmental undertakings.  Ordinance 2005-1086-E, under which the program was originally established, is repealed, and all references in Ordinance 2005-1085-E to Ordinance 2005-1086-E are amended to refer instead to this ordinance (2006-888).  Conflicting ordinances and resolutions are waived to the extent of any such conflict.

 

Background Information:  Information from the Administration and Finance Dept. states that the Banking Fund ordinance technical revisions were requested by bond counsel.

 

Policy Impact Area:  Bonds; Capital Improvements

 

Fiscal Impact:  Undetermined
